    Consent-o-matic instead of cookies and adnausem instead of ublock origin.

    Consent-o-matic will actively opt out of popups.

    Adnausem is built on top of ublock origin and will silently “click” on the ads behind the scenes to mess up your advertising profile and cost the advertisers money.

    the return dislike plugin is just stupid. it’s a community database now, so rather than being based on the actual number of dislikes on youtube it’s based on the dislikes of the people who have the plugin.

    it used to be that it actually got the real numbers but youtube removed that endpoint so now it’s just a misanthropic echo chamber.
